package main
import "fmt"
// 数组的定义 var 数组变量名 [元素数量]T
func def_array() {
var a [3]int
a[0] = 0
a[1] = 1
a[2] = 2
fmt.Println(a)
}
// 数组是值传递
func modifyarray(a [3]string) {
a[0] = "加拿大"
}
func initArray() {
a := [3]int{}
fmt.Println(a)
var numArray = [3]int{1, 2, 3}
fmt.Println(numArray)
}
func main() {
a := [3]string{"美国", "新加坡", "台湾"}
fmt.Println(a)
modifyarray(a)
fmt.Println(a)
b := [2][3]string{
{"a", "b", "c"},
{"d", "e", "f"},
}
fmt.Println(b)
}
数组的使用
©著作权归作者所有,转载或内容合作请联系作者
- 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
- 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
- 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...
推荐阅读更多精彩内容
- 类数组:-从DOM文档中取得的一堆同种class类的数组类数组不是数组,不能直接使用数组的方法,如forEach(...
- 一、说明 Java 提供一个类可以解决数组的动态长度的问题,它就是 ArrayList 类,即泛型数组列表,也就是...
- 最近在拼接后台字符串、数组发现很多新奇的东西,整理如下,以备后查! splice用法排坑 基本用法:截取数组,sp...